Overview

Shrine of Ancestors is an epilogue location connected to Kisha’s return after the story conclusion. The content pack states that Kisha returns here to hit “return” after the epilogue. It also describes the ending structure as a single ending with Stone of Narrative segments, extra cycles after the epilogue, and memory fragments replacing previously collected heart or mana pieces. That makes the shrine a post-ending control point rather than a normal Act 1 to Act 3 region.

How to Reach

Reach Shrine of Ancestors after Sealed Spire and the epilogue sequence. The source pack’s confirmed note is direct: Kisha returns here to hit “return” after the epilogue. Because it is an epilogue location, do not expect it to behave like a normal mid-route biome with a first-entry movement requirement.

The practical requirement is story completion. You should have resolved the final-area route and reached the post-ending state. If you are not seeing the shrine return sequence, review whether Sealed Spire is fully cleared, whether the ending has played, and whether Stone of Narrative content has changed your file state.

Movement tools still matter for cleanup after you leave the shrine. Blink, Mutated Abilities, Engraved Skills, Cabitz, Silver Claw, Silver Chain, and Meditation of Jibanam may all become relevant once the postgame route sends you back through old regions. The shrine itself is the state marker; the wider world is where those tools become useful again.

Collectibles & Secrets

The important secret behavior is post-epilogue replacement. The content pack says memory fragments replace previously collected heart or mana pieces in extra cycles. That means the Shrine of Ancestors is a cue to re-check the world, not just a place to press a prompt and stop playing.

Use the shrine as the start of a cleanup checklist. Review Carox markers, unfinished sanctuary routes, old heart and mana pickup locations, and achievements that depend on postgame state. The content pack highlights This Settles My Debt as a postgame cleanup chain involving Cain, Aisare Stone Shards, Archive progress, and ending-state dependencies. Do not assume that all relevant tasks were available before the epilogue.
